Kunze wrote: >> >>> Hi, >>> >>> a colleague of mine (I write this mail because I am on the list) has >>> the following issue: >>> >>> >>> for x in my_iterable: >>> # do >>> empty: >>> # do something else >>> >>> >>> What's the most Pythonic way of doing this? >> >> What would you expect? >> >>>>> class Empty(Exception): pass >> ... >>>>> def check_empty(items): >> ... items = iter(items) >> ... try: >> ... yield next(items) >> ... except StopIteration: >> ... raise Empty ... yield from items ... >>>>> try: >> ... for item in check_empty("abc"): print(item) >> ... except Empty: print("oops") >> ... >> a >> b >> c >>>>> try: >> ... for item in check_empty(""): print(item) >> ... except Empty: print("oops") >> ... >> oops >> >> I'm kidding, of course. Keep it simple and use a flag like you would in >> any other language: >> >> empty = True: >> for item in items: >> empty = False ... >> if empty: >> ... > > or even use the loop variable as the flag > > item=None > for item in items: > #do stuff > if ex is None: > #do something else > Did you test this? :) -- My fellow Pythonistas, ask not what our language can do for you, ask what you can do for our language.
